Recent peace talks between Russia and Ukraine in Istanbul have yielded little progress toward a ceasefire, despite international pressure and proposals for high-level summits involving leaders like Zelenskyy, Putin, Trump, and Erdogan. While both sides agreed to further prisoner exchanges, negotiations remain deadlocked, with Russia insisting on achieving its war objectives before considering peace. Ukraine continues to push for direct talks between Zelenskyy and Putin, but the Kremlin downplays expectations and signals no interest in a ceasefire. The ongoing conflict has resulted in continued civilian casualties and intensified attacks, underscoring the urgency but also the difficulty of reaching a diplomatic solution. International actors, including the U.S., are increasing pressure on Russia, but hopes for a breakthrough remain low.
